Product Summary  
An atmosphere furnace with an oxygen concentration of 20ppm and a maximum operating temperature of 600℃, suitable for high-temperature thermal treatment in an oxygenf-ree environment.
   
Features  
Maximum operating temperatures of 360°C and 600°C, with oxygen concentrations below 20ppm, primarily applied in electronic component annealing, LTCC removal, glass substrate annealing, ceramic debinding, etc
High gas-tightness pressure chamber construction, short oxygen concentration reaching time, low N2 consumption
Maintaining high gas-tightness through magnetic sealing and a water-cooling mechanism to protect sealing components from thermal effects
Quick heating and cooling achievable, with adjustable heating and cooling rates
Standard equipped with waste liquid recovery devices to cool and recover gases
Liquid crystal touchscreen operation, with both automatic and manual operation modes
Safety:Equipped with door detection switch, temperature overheating preventer, oxygen concentration abnormality detection, nitrogen pressure detection, nitrogen flow detection, cooling water flow detection, leakage sensor, overcurrent leakage protection and other devices
   
   
Specifications  
Specification Item Details
Model DNN660C
Type Inert Oven
System Nitrogen replacement + Forced convection
Operating temperature range Room temp.+50~600℃
GB standard Temp. fluctuation ±0.5℃(600℃)
Temperature deviation ±1.5℃(at 100℃), ±2℃(at 200℃), ±4℃(at 300℃), ±6℃(at 400℃), ±8℃(at 600℃)
Temp. adjustment accuracy ±0.5℃(600℃)
Temp. distribution accuracy ±8℃(600℃)
Max. temp. reaching time Approx. 150 min
Oxygen concentration Below 20ppm
Oxygen concentration reaching time ≤25 min (250L/min nitrogen)
Composition Interior material Stainless steel plate
Exterior material Cold rolled steel plate with chemical proofing coating
Insulating material Aluminosilicate cotton
Heating method Stainless steel heating pipe Alloy heating wire
Heating power Main heater 14.2KW,N2 preheating 1KW
Cooling mechanism Stainless steel cooling water heat exchanger
Controllers Temp. control method PID control
Temperature controller Liquid crystal touchscreen + PLC
Operation functions Manual fixed temp. operation, automatic program operation
Program mode 9 program operations, each program can set 9 segments (expandable)
Additional functions Operator level certification
Heater circuit control SSR drive
Sensors K-type thermocouple (temperature control and overheating prevention)
Safety device Door detection switch, overheating preventer, oxygen concentration abnormality, temperature overheating of N2 preheating, low water pressure detection, low N2 pressure detection, cooling water flow detection, N2 flow detection, fan overload detection, overcurrent leakage protection, etc.
Internal dimensions (width × depth × height mm) 660×600×660
External dimensions (width x depth x height mm) 1450×1160×1930
Internal capacity 261L
Shelf layer / spacing 19 layers/ 30mm
Exhaust vent 40KF flange
Nitrogen inlet Rc1/2
Cooling water inlet Rc3/4
Hot water outlet Rc3/4, 2 units
Power Source 3 phase AC380V 28A
Weight Approx. 1000kg

Q4: What is the temperature distribution accuracy of the oven? A: Even while continuously maintaining a 20ppm nitrogen-rich environment at extreme temperatures, the DNN series utilizes an advanced forced convection system to deliver elite thermal control. The 360°C models provide a strict temperature deviation/distribution accuracy of ±5.0°C (at 360°C) with an internal temperature fluctuation of just ±0.3°C. The extreme 600°C models provide a temperature deviation of ±8.0°C (at 600°C) with a fluctuation of just ±0.5°C, ensuring highly uniform thermal profiling across the entire chamber.

Q11: When and why should we use this oven? A: You MUST choose the DNN series when your highly sensitive components require thermal processing that is completely free of oxidation risks (under 20ppm oxygen) AND requires extreme high heat (up to 600°C). Standard inert ovens typically max out at 360°C and cannot maintain 20ppm, while standard 600°C ovens will instantly destroy oxygen-sensitive materials. The DNN provides this uncompromised, specific dual-capability. Note: If you also require ''Class 100'' dust-free cleanroom specs alongside 20ppm, you would upgrade to the DTN series.
